
Moreira da Silva
Moreira da Silva was a renowned Brazilian samba singer and composer, influential in the development of the genre, particularly in the 20th century. Known for his charismatic performances and poetic lyrics, he remains a significant reference for contemporary samba musicians, including Mosquito, who draws inspiration from his work.
Born on Feb 05, 1902 (123 years old)
